MySQL telepítése és használata

A 3. beadandó elkészítéséhez szükséges egy MySQL adatbázisszerver telepítése és alapszintű használata. Az alábbiakban ehhez találtok segítséget:

Telepítés

  1. A MySQL szervert és a hozzá tartozó parancssoros kliensprogramot Ubuntura, Debianra és használó disztibúciókra a sudo apt-get install mysql-server mysql-client paranccsal tudjátok telepíteni.
  2. A telepítés közben a szerver meg fogja kérdezni a root felhasználó jelszavát. Ezt legegyszerűbb root-ra állítani (a példaprogramokban is így van, így nem kell mindenhol átírni).

Ha a telepítés sikeresen befejeződött, a szerver azonnal el is indul, tehát további teendőtök nincs vele, lehet használni. Ha mégsem, a gép újraindítása után biztosan futni fog a szerver.

Mintaadatok feltöltése

Az előadáshoz kapcsolódó példaprogramok mellé minden esetben be van csomagolva egy .sql fájl. Ez egy adatbázis parancsfájl, melyet a MySQL kliensben lefuttatva létrehozza a programhoz szükséges adatábzis és feltölti alapadatokkal. A fájl lefuttatásához:

  1. Indítsd el a MySQL kliensprogramot konzolból a mysql -u root -p paranccsal!
  2. A kliens kérdezni fogja a jelszót, ezt add meg (pl. root)!
  3. Ha elindult a kliens (a promtnak kb. úgy kell kinéznie, hogy mysql>), akkor a source az_sql_fajl_eleresi_utja_es_neve.sql parancs kiadásával futtathatjátok a prancsfájlt.
  4. A futás során a kliens nyugtázó üzeneteket ír ki. Ha végzett, a kliensből az exit paranccsal léphettek ki.

Ezután már elvileg elég lefordítani és futtatni a példaprogramokat. Esetleg, ha a root-tól eltérő jelszót állítottatok be, akkor ezt a main.cpp fájl megfelelő sorában át kell írni.

Ha valami nem megy...

Ha a folyamatban bárhol elakadtok, vagy valami más nem megy, írjatok nekem nyugodtan e-mailt, amiben írjátok le, hogy meddig jutottatok el, mi sikerült, mi nem és mi volt a hibaüzenet.